[oe-commits] [openembedded-core] 03/03: mdadm: add -Wno-error to DEBUG_OPTIMIZATION

git at git.openembedded.org git at git.openembedded.org
Mon Mar 25 11:55:00 UTC 2019


This is an automated email from the git hooks/post-receive script.

rpurdie pushed a commit to branch master-next
in repository openembedded-core.

commit 2ee7acfd4bb5e7b910af620294b66b61b0c9380f
Author: Changqing Li <changqing.li at windriver.com>
AuthorDate: Fri Mar 22 11:57:48 2019 +0800

    mdadm: add -Wno-error to DEBUG_OPTIMIZATION
    
    when compile with DEBUG_OPTIMIZATION(-Og), compile failed with below
    error, fix by add -Wno-error:
    
    [snip]
    | Incremental.c: In function 'Incremental_container':
    | Incremental.c:1593:3: error: 'mdfd' may be used uninitialized in this function [-Werror=maybe-uninitialized]
    | close(mdfd);
    | ^~~~~~~~~~~
    
    [snip]
    super-intel.c: In function 'apply_takeover_update':
    | super-intel.c:9615:15: error: '%d' directive writing between 1 and 11 bytes into a region of size 7 [-Werror=format-overflow=]
    | " MISSING_%d", du->index);
    | ^~
    ...
    
    Signed-off-by: Changqing Li <changqing.li at windriver.com>
    Signed-off-by: Richard Purdie <richard.purdie at linuxfoundation.org>
---
 meta/recipes-extended/mdadm/mdadm_4.1.bb |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/meta/recipes-extended/mdadm/mdadm_4.1.bb b/meta/recipes-extended/mdadm/mdadm_4.1.bb
index 6b32f08..9862a38 100644
--- a/meta/recipes-extended/mdadm/mdadm_4.1.bb
+++ b/meta/recipes-extended/mdadm/mdadm_4.1.bb
@@ -41,6 +41,8 @@ CFLAGS_append_mipsarchn32 = ' -D__SANE_USERSPACE_TYPES__'
 
 EXTRA_OEMAKE = 'CHECK_RUN_DIR=0 CXFLAGS="${CFLAGS}"'
 
+DEBUG_OPTIMIZATION_append = " -Wno-error"
+
 do_compile() {
 	# Point to right sbindir
 	sed -i -e "s;BINDIR  = /sbin;BINDIR = $base_sbindir;" -e "s;UDEVDIR = /lib;UDEVDIR = $nonarch_base_libdir;" ${S}/Makefile

-- 
To stop receiving notification emails like this one, please contact
the administrator of this repository.


More information about the Openembedded-commits mailing list